绘色屏幕网
首页 屏幕知识 正文

屏幕缩放算法:从原理到应用

来源:绘色屏幕网 2024-07-10 22:54:28

屏幕缩放算法:从原理到应用(1)

引言

  随着移设备的普及和屏幕尺寸的不断增大,屏幕缩放算法越来越受到绘~色~屏~幕~网。屏幕缩放算法是指将一个尺寸固定的界面适配到不同尺寸的屏幕上的过程。文将从算法原理、应用场景和常问题等方面进行讲解,希望读对屏幕缩放算法有更深入的了解。

算法原理

  屏幕缩放算法的核心原理是将原始界面进行等比例缩放,以适应不同尺寸的屏幕。在具体实现中,常的算法有以下种:

  1. 固定比例缩放算法

  该算法是最简单的缩放算法,它将原始界面按照固定比例进行缩放。例如,将原始界面按照1.5倍的比例进行缩放,即可适配1.5倍尺寸的屏幕。该算法的优点是简单易懂,但是会造成界面变形,影响用户体验www.724shop.net

  2. 等比例缩放算法

  该算法是将原始界面按照屏幕宽高比例进行缩放。例如,将原始界面按照屏幕宽度进行缩放,保持宽高比例不变,即可适配不同尺寸的屏幕。该算法的优点是可以保持界面的比例不变,但是会出现黑边或界面过小的问题。

3. 自适应缩放算法

  该算法是根据不同尺寸的屏幕进行自适应缩放,使得界面在不同尺寸的屏幕上都能完美适配。该算法的优点是可以保持界面的比例不变,同时适配不同尺寸的屏幕,但是需要更复杂的算法实现。

屏幕缩放算法:从原理到应用(2)

应用场景

  屏幕缩放算法在移设备、电等多个领域都有广泛的应用724shop.net。以下是常的应用场景:

1. 移应用

  在移应用中,不同尺寸的屏幕都有可能出现。为了保证用户体验,需要对界面进行适配。例如,将按钮大小、字体大小等进行自适应缩放,使得界面在不同尺寸的屏幕上都能完美适配。

  2. 电应用

  在电应用中,屏幕尺寸相对固定,但是分辨率却不同。为了保证用户体验,需要对界面进行自适应缩放,使得界面在不同分辨率的电上都能完美适配。

  3. 游戏应用

在游戏应用中,界面的适配更为重要724shop.net。不同尺寸的屏幕、不同分辨率的设备都会影响游戏的体验。因此,需要对游戏界面进行自适应缩放,以适应不同的设备。

屏幕缩放算法:从原理到应用(3)

问题

  在屏幕缩放算法的实现中,常会出现以下问题:

  1. 界面变形

在固定比例缩放算法中,由于缩放比例固定,会造成界面变形。为了解决这个问题,可以使用等比例缩放算法或自适应缩放算法。

  2. 黑边问题

  在等比例缩放算法中,由于屏幕宽高比例不同,会出现黑边问题。为了解决这个问题,可以使用自适应缩放算法,根据具体屏幕尺寸进行缩放欢迎www.724shop.net

  3. 界面过小问题

  在等比例缩放算法中,由于屏幕尺寸过小,会出现界面过小的问题。为了解决这个问题,可以使用自适应缩放算法,根据具体屏幕尺寸进行缩放。

结论

  屏幕缩放算法是移设备、电等多个领域中的重要技术。通过等比例缩放、固定比例缩放和自适应缩放等算法,可以实现界面在不同尺寸的屏幕上的适配。在实际应用中,需要根据具体场景择合适的算法,并针对常问题进行优化。

我说两句
0 条评论
请遵守当地法律法规
最新评论

还没有评论,快来做评论第一人吧!
相关文章
最新更新
最新推荐